Method and apparatus for predictive operation of a communication system
First Claim
1. In a communication system comprisinga system control segment,one or more subscriber units dispersed throughout one or more geographical regions, andone or more routing devices which support communication traffic from the subscriber units and which exchange system information with the system control segment,a method for predictively controlling operations of the communication system comprising the steps of:
- a. creating, by the system control segment, a subscriber traffic prediction of future traffic during a future time set, the subscriber traffic prediction based on historical traffic data correlated with the geographical regions that the one or more routing devices will support during the future time set and also correlated with previous temporal events having characteristics of the future time set;
b. generating, by the system control segment, a system operational plan for at least the future time set based on the subscriber traffic prediction;
c. sending a portion of the system operational plan to each of the one or more routing devices;
d. executing the portion of the system operational plan during the future time set, by the one or more routing devices, by conforming operations to the system operational plan during the future time set; and
e. before an end of the future time set, creating a next subscriber traffic prediction for a next future time set and repeating steps b-e using the next subscriber traffic prediction for the next future time set.
3 Assignments
0 Petitions
Accused Products
Abstract
A method and apparatus for controlling operations of a cellular communication system having multiple satellites, multiple subscriber units which communicate through the multiple satellites, and a system control segment which creates a subscriber traffic prediction and manages operation of the communication system. The method includes the steps of decomposing a traffic prediction request into regional traffic requests; determining a regional traffic prediction for each regional traffic request based on past regional traffic history; and combining the regional traffic requests into a consolidated subscriber traffic prediction. The subscriber traffic prediction is then used to determine a system operational plan which controls operations of the communication system.
108 Citations
30 Claims
-
1. In a communication system comprising
a system control segment, one or more subscriber units dispersed throughout one or more geographical regions, and one or more routing devices which support communication traffic from the subscriber units and which exchange system information with the system control segment, a method for predictively controlling operations of the communication system comprising the steps of: -
a. creating, by the system control segment, a subscriber traffic prediction of future traffic during a future time set, the subscriber traffic prediction based on historical traffic data correlated with the geographical regions that the one or more routing devices will support during the future time set and also correlated with previous temporal events having characteristics of the future time set; b. generating, by the system control segment, a system operational plan for at least the future time set based on the subscriber traffic prediction; c. sending a portion of the system operational plan to each of the one or more routing devices; d. executing the portion of the system operational plan during the future time set, by the one or more routing devices, by conforming operations to the system operational plan during the future time set; and e. before an end of the future time set, creating a next subscriber traffic prediction for a next future time set and repeating steps b-e using the next subscriber traffic prediction for the next future time set.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. In a communication system comprising
a system control segment, and one or more routing devices, a method for predictively controlling operations of the communication system comprising the steps of: -
a. creating, by the system control segment, a subscriber traffic prediction; b. generating, by the system control segment, a system operational plan based on the subscriber traffic prediction; and c. executing the system operational plan, by the one or more routing devices, by conforming operations to the system operational plan, wherein step (b) comprises the steps of; b.1. determining, by the system control segment, acceptable energy consumption of the one or more routing devices based on the subscriber traffic prediction; and b.2. incorporating the acceptable energy consumption into the system operational plan.
-
-
18. In a communication system comprising
a system control segment, and one or more routing devices, a method for predictively controlling operations of the communication system comprising the steps of: -
a. creating, by the system control segment, a subscriber traffic prediction; b. generating, by the system control segment, a system operational plan based on the subscriber traffic prediction; and c. executing the system operational plan, by the one or more routing devices, by conforming operations to the system operational plan, wherein step (b) further comprises the steps of; b.1. determining, by the system control segment, allowable access numbers based on the subscriber traffic prediction, and b.2. incorporating the allowable access numbers into the system operational plan, and wherein step (c) further comprises the steps of; c.1. broadcasting, by the one or more routing devices, the allowable access numbers to subscriber units having resident memory devices containing particular access numbers, and c.2. refusing, by the one or more routing devices, to allow subscriber units having the particular access numbers that are different from the allowable access numbers to access communication channels.
-
-
19. In a communication system comprising
a system control segment, and one or more routing devices which provide communication channels, a method for interfacing subscriber units with the communication system comprising the steps of: -
a. determining, by the system control segment, one or more allowable access numbers based on a subscriber traffic prediction; b. broadcasting, by the one or more routing devices, the one or more allowable access numbers; and c. utilizing, by the subscriber units, the communication channels when the one or more allowable access numbers broadcast by the one or more routing devices are compatible with particular access numbers contained within resident memory devices of the subscriber units.
-
-
20. In a communication system comprising
a system control segment, and one or more routing devices which provide communication channels, a method for interfacing a particular subscriber unit with the communication system comprising the steps of: -
a. transmitting, by the particular subscriber unit, identification information to the system control segment where the identification information is used to generate a system operational plan which includes one or more allowable access numbers; and b. attempting to utilize, by the particular subscriber unit, one of the communication channels when the one or more routing devices broadcast the one or more allowable access numbers and one of the one or more allowable access numbers is compatible with a particular access number contained within a resident memory device of the particular subscriber unit.
-
-
21. In a communication system comprising
a system control segment, a method for operating the communication system comprising the steps of: -
a. creating, by the system control segment, a subscriber traffic prediction for one or more geographic regions during a future time set, wherein the subscriber traffic prediction is created by utilizing call data records describing call attempts, subscriber units, and calls handled by the subscriber units within the one or more geographic regions; b. generating, by the system control segment, a system operational plan that is executed during the future time set based on the subscriber traffic prediction; c. sending a portion of the system operational plan to each of the one or more routing devices; and d. before an end of the future time set, creating a next subscriber traffic prediction for a next future time set and repeating steps b-d using the next subscriber traffic prediction for the next future time set.
-
-
22. In a communication system comprising
a system control segment having a memory device, one or more routing devices which provide communication channels to a surface of a celestial body, and multiple subscriber units dispersed throughout one or more geographical regions on the surface of the celestial body, wherein the multiple subscriber units are movable with respect to the surface of the celestial body, and at least two of the multiple subscriber units are capable of exchanging communication traffic with each other over the communication channels, a method for operating the communication system comprising the steps of: -
a. collecting, by the system control segment, data describing the communication traffic exchanged between the multiple subscriber units; b. storing, by the system control segment, the data in a traffic history database located in the memory device; c. creating, by the system control segment, a subscriber traffic prediction of future traffic based on the data in the traffic history database wherein the subscriber traffic prediction is correlated with the geographical regions that the multiple subscriber units are dispersed throughout during a future time set; and d. controlling operation of the one or more routing devices, by the system control segment during the future time set, based on the subscriber traffic prediction. - View Dependent Claims (23, 24)
-
-
25. In a communication system controlled by a system control segment, and comprising
one or more routing devices, where at least one of the one or more routing devices moves with respect to a surface of a celestial body, a method for operating the communication system comprising the steps of: -
a. providing communication channels, by the one or more routing devices, for exchanging communication traffic between multiple subscriber units; b. broadcasting one or more access numbers, by the one or more routing devices, determined from a subscriber traffic prediction; c. allowing, by the one or more routing devices, communication channel access by particular subscriber units having individual access numbers that are compatible with the one or more access numbers broadcast by the one or more routing devices; and d. denying, by the one or more routing devices, the communication channel access to other subscriber units when a number of subscriber units attempting to utilize the communication channels exceeds a threshold contained within a system operational plan which is derived from the subscriber traffic prediction.
-
-
26. In a communication system controlled by a system control segment, and comprising
one or more routing devices, a method for operating the communication system comprising the steps of: -
a. providing one or more communication channels, by the one or more routing devices, for exchanging communication traffic between multiple subscriber units which are mobile; b. broadcasting one or more access numbers, by the one or more routing devices, determined from a subscriber traffic prediction; c. allowing, by the one or more routing devices, communication channel access to particular subscriber units having individual access numbers that are compatible with the one or more access numbers broadcast by the one or more routing devices; and d. denying, by the one or more routing devices, the communication channel access to other subscriber units when a number of subscriber units attempting to utilize the communication channels exceeds a threshold contained within a system operational plan which is derived from the subscriber traffic prediction.
-
-
27. In a communication system comprising
a system control segment, one or more routing devices which provide at least one communication channel, where at least one of the one or more routing devices moves with respect to a surface of a celestial body, and multiple subscriber units which are mobile, and which communicate with each other through the one or more routing devices, a method for operating the communication system comprising: -
a. deriving, by the system control segment, traffic models from a collection of call data records describing particular calls between the multiple subscriber units; b. determining, by the system control segment, a subscriber traffic prediction based on a set of the traffic models, wherein the subscriber traffic prediction predicts subscriber traffic for a future time set; c. generating, by the system control segment, a system operational plan for the future time set from the subscriber traffic prediction; d. distributing, by the system control segment, portions of the system operational plan to the one or more routing devices; and e. executing the system operational plan, by the one or more routing devices, by conforming operations to the portions of the system operational plan during the future time set.
-
-
28. A cellular communication system comprising:
-
a system control segment, which creates a subscriber traffic prediction based on call data records, and which also creates a system operational plan based on the subscriber traffic prediction, and which also creates individual plans based on the system operational plan; one or more satellites, which receive the individual plans from the system control segment, and conform operations to the individual plans, and broadcast access information contained within the individual plans; and multiple subscriber units, which contain resident memory devices having access numbers which allow a particular subscriber unit to determine whether the particular subscriber unit may access the cellular communication system based on the access information broadcast by the one or more satellites.
-
-
29. A satellite communication subsystem for use in a cellular communication system comprising
multiple satellites, at least some of which are moving with respect to a surface of a celestial body, each of the multiple satellites containing communication resources including one or more transmitters and receivers for providing communication with at least one subscriber unit, and having at least two devices for receiving and transmitting electromagnetic energy coupled to the one or more transmitters and receivers, said subsystem comprising: -
satellite resident memory containing an individual operational plan provided to the multiple satellites by a system control segment, the individual operational plan for operating the multiple satellites for a future time set, the individual operational plan being based on a subscriber traffic prediction for the future time set and correlated to geographical regions over which the multiple satellites orbit, the individual operational plan causing the multiple satellites to change a satellite'"'"'s mode of operation at predetermined times during the future time set; and a satellite resident controller coupled to the satellite resident memory and the one or more transmitters and receivers, the satellite resident controller for actuating the one or more transmitters and receivers in accordance with communication traffic passing through the multiple satellites in a manner determined by the individual operational plan stored in the satellite resident memory.
-
-
30. A circuit for use by a subscriber unit in a communication system comprising a system control segment and one or more routing devices which provide communication channels, said circuit interfacing said subscriber unit with the communication system and comprising:
-
means for transmitting identification information to the system control segment where the identification information is used to generate a system operational plan which includes one or more allowable access numbers; and means for attempting to utilize one of the communication channels when the one or more routing devices broadcast the one or more allowable access numbers and one of the allowable access numbers is compatible with a particular access number contained within a resident memory device of the particular subscriber unit.
-
Specification